Zora
From the description:
Inspired by a vintage 1920s pattern, Zora is a smart cardigan that features an open shawl collar and the long lines typical of the Jazz Age. Just like its namesake, the intrepid American author and folklorist Zora Neale Hurston, this cardigan is relaxed yet sophisticated in any setting.
FINISHED MEASUREMENTS
- Bust: 34.75(37.5, 42.75, 45.5, 50.75, 53.5, 58.7) inches
- Hip: 37.5(40, 45.5, 48, 53.5, 56, 61.5) inches
- Length: 24(25, 26, 27, 27.5, 28.5, 29.50 inches
Note: Garment is intended to be worn with approx. 3-5 inches positive ease.
GAUGE
- 24 sts/32 rows = 4 inches in stockinette st and in Quatrefoil Eyelet Pattern
- 32 sts/32 rows = 4 inches in 2x2 Rib
- 24 sts/48 rows = 4 inches in garter st
